簡體   English   中英

從Word文檔獲取所有書簽

[英]Get All Bookmarks from Word Document

我一直在尋找解決這個問題的方法。

我需要從Word文檔中提取所有書簽,以便可以隨意操作它們。 所以我想我只需要引用它們而不是實際的書簽即可。

到目前為止,我發現的只是解決方案,您需要搜索書簽的名稱,但我只想獲取所有書簽的引用。 我可能一直都不知道他們的名字。 我以為可以通過調用MyDocument.Bookmarks來獲得書簽,但是到目前為止,我仍然沒有弄清楚如何使用該屬性。

如果我從模板中提取書簽,則名稱不會更改。 但是,如果我從一個未知的文檔中獲取書簽,我將不知道如何獲取引用。

有什么幫助嗎?

foreach (Bookmark bookmark in document.Bookmarks)
{
    // Do whatever you want with the bookmark.
}

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M